PD‐1‐induced T cell exhaustion is controlled by a Drp1‐dependent mechanism
2022
Programmed cell death‐1 (PD‐1) signaling downregulates the T‐cell response, promoting an exhausted state in tumor‐infiltrating T cells, through mostly unveiled molecular mechanisms. Dynamin‐related protein‐1 (Drp1)‐dependent mitochondrial fission plays a crucial role in sustaining T‐cell motility, proliferation, survival, and glycolytic engagement. Interestingly, such processes are exactly those inhibited by PD‐1 in tumor‐infiltrating T cells. Here, we show that PD‐1pos CD8+ T cells infiltrating an MC38 (murine adenocarcinoma)‐derived murine tumor mass have a downregulated Drp1 activity and more elongated mitochondria compared with PD‐1neg counterparts. Early Parental Death and Risk of Psychosis in Offspring: A Six-Country Case-Control Study
2019
Evidence for early parental death as a risk factor for psychosis in offspring is inconclusive. We analyzed data from a six-country, case-control study to examine the associations of early parental death, type of death (maternal, paternal, both), and child’s age at death with psychosis, both overall and by ethnic group. In fully adjusted multivariable mixed-effects logistic regression models, experiencing early parental death was associated with 1.54-fold greater odds of psychosis (95% confidence interval (CI): 1.23, 1.92). Saving Technologies that are not Used to Save Lives
2021
A hundred years ago in July, thanks to the advancement of medical technology, the first human received the vaccine Bacille Calmette-Guérin—or BCG—to prevent tuberculosis (TB), a disease that killed at least 20% of the European population during the 19th century. Since then, hundreds of millions of lives have been saved by BCG, as well as other vaccinations for dangerous diseases. However, although TB is quite preventable and curable, it remains the leading cause of death from a single infectious agent in the world.
